Michelle Obama and Oprah Winfrey Get Real in Upcoming Netflix Special

Photo credit: Amy Sussman/Getty Images for ABA

A new Netflix special featuring Michelle Obama and Oprah Winfrey is set to air April 25. “The Light We Carry: Michelle Obama and Oprah Winfrey,” is adapted from an intimate conversation between the former first lady and the media mogul.
